Eri
Eri is a girl in Boku no Hero Academia whose tragic past makes her one of the most important characters in the series. She is the granddaughter of the boss of the Shie Hassaikai yakuza group, but after her parents abandoned her out of fear of her power, she fell under the cruel control of Overhaul (Kai Chisaki), who exploited her for his experiments.
Her Quirk is called Rewind, an extraordinary ability that allows her to reverse a living being’s body back to a previous state. This can undo injuries, remove mutations, or even cause someone to disappear if rewound too far. Because it’s so unstable, Eri has trouble controlling it, and for most of her life it has been more of a curse than a gift. However, with training and guidance, she begins to learn how to use it to help others, such as when she saved Izuku Midoriya during his fight against Overhaul.
Physically, Eri is a girl with pale skin, large innocent red eyes, and long, silvery-blue hair that falls past her waist. Her most distinctive feature is a small horn on the right side of her forehead, which grows or shrinks depending on how much power she builds up.
Personality-wise, Eri is shy, quiet, and initially very fearful due to years of abuse. She struggles with guilt, believing herself dangerous to those around her. Yet, under the care of Class 1-A and Pro Heroes, especially Mirio Togata and Izuku, her kind, gentle, and curious nature slowly shines through. At heart, she is sweet and compassionate, yearning to experience the normal childhood she was denied.
Aizawa Shota
Aizawa Shota, also known by his hero name Eraser Head, is a pro hero and a teacher at U.A. High School, where he trains aspiring heroes. He's known for his strict and logical approach to teaching, valuing results and practicality over flashy appearances.
His quirk, Erasure, allows him to nullify another person's quirk just by looking at them. However, the effect stops if he blinks or if his line of sight is broken, making it a quirk that requires focus and physical stamina. He also uses a special scarf in combat to restrain enemies while their quirks are disabled.
Aizawa has a slim, tall build, with long messy black hair and tired-looking black eyes. He usually wears a black outfit with a capture weapon scarf and often looks like he hasn’t slept in days. Despite his disheveled appearance, he's highly skilled and intelligent.
His personality is serious, calm, and blunt. He rarely shows strong emotions and prefers to observe and act only when necessary. Though he seems cold, he deeply cares for his students and will go to great lengths to protect them.
UA
In the world of My Hero Academia, U.A. High School (short for U.A. High) is the most prestigious school in Japan for training future professional heroes. Located in Musutafu, this elite academy is famous for its high standards, powerful teachers, and exceptional students. It offers various departments, but the most well-known is the Hero Course, where students learn to use their Quirks responsibly and effectively in real combat situations.
To enter the Hero Course, students must pass a highly competitive entrance exam, which typically involves physical trials and rescue scenarios that test both strength and judgment. Only a small number of applicants are accepted each year, making admission a major accomplishment.
U.A. is also home to other departments, such as the Support Course (for creating hero gadgets), the General Studies Course, and the Business Course. Each plays a role in the broader hero industry.
The school is known for its unique teaching methods. For example, students participate in dangerous, realistic training exercises like the U.A. Sports Festival and simulated villain attacks. The goal is to prepare students for the threats heroes face in real life.
U.A. also employs top Pro Heroes as instructors—like Shota Aizawa (Eraser Head) and All Might, the Symbol of Peace—who offer expert guidance and mentorship.
More than just a school, U.A. represents hope for society, raising the next generation of heroes in a world where villain activity continues to rise.
Quirks context
the world of My Hero Academia, a Quirk is a unique, superhuman ability that most people are born with. About 80% of the global population has a Quirk, and no two Quirks are exactly alike, although some may share similar traits. Quirks typically manifest around the age of four and are influenced by the abilities of one's parents, though they can combine or mutate into something completely new.
Quirks can range from simple powers—like generating fire or manipulating ice—to more complex ones like teleportation, super strength, or even the ability to erase other Quirks. Some are passive and affect the user’s body or senses, while others are active and must be triggered. People without Quirks are called Quirkless, and they are a small minority, often facing social discrimination.
In society, Quirks play a major role in shaping careers and personal identity. Some people use their powers to become Pro Heroes, licensed individuals who protect civilians and fight villains. Others may use their powers illegally, becoming villains.
While Quirks are powerful, they often come with drawbacks—such as physical strain or strict limitations. Mastering a Quirk takes training, discipline, and understanding its strengths and weaknesses.
Quirks are central to both the story and characters of My Hero Academia, driving the action, challenges, and dreams of heroes in training.
